Needs-assessment survey draws 902 responses; board to convene youth-sports focus group
The Eastern Delaware County Joint Recreation District’s consultant-led needs assessment has drawn a high level of public response: an unidentified presenter reported 902 survey responses and said roughly 80–81% of respondents are from the district’s three member jurisdictions.

“We have 902 at the last count,” the presenter said, adding the consultant is preparing a summary of the findings and the survey remains open for another short outreach push. The presenter said the majority of feedback has been positive but that residents raised questions about financing and potential locations for future facilities.

To gather additional input focused on programming and facility needs, the presenter said the project team will convene a youth-sports stakeholder focus group later this month and asked board members to forward names and contact information for youth-sports representatives. The presenter named local baseball and softball contacts and asked members to help reach hockey groups and other sport organizations.

The board said it expects to receive the consultants’ summary before the next board meeting and noted consultants are scheduled to complete the study by March, with community engagement continuing in January and February. The presenter recommended at least one more community outreach announcement before closing the current survey.

Context and next steps
Board members emphasized the value of in-person outreach and discussed options to host larger public meetings as turnout rises. The consultants will present a summary to the board at an upcoming meeting and will continue community engagement in early 2026 as part of the study’s timeline.
